Creating a cozy home office isn’t just about aesthetics—it’s about designing a space that makes you feel comfortable, focused, and inspired every day. Whether you’re working from home full-time or just need a productive corner, a warm and inviting setup can completely transform your work experience.
1. Add Soft Lighting for a Warm Glow
Harsh overhead lighting can make your workspace feel cold and uninviting. Instead, go for warm, layered lighting.
Use:
Table lamps
Floor lamps
String lights
Warm light instantly makes your home office feel more relaxing and less like a corporate setup.


2. Use a Comfortable Chair (That Still Looks Good)
A cozy office starts with comfort. Choose a chair that supports your posture but also fits your aesthetic.
Look for:
Cushioned seating
Neutral or soft fabric
Ergonomic design
You’ll spend hours sitting—make it count.


3. Layer with Rugs and Textiles
Adding a rug under your desk can instantly warm up the space.
Try:
Soft neutral rugs
Textured throws
Linen or cotton curtains
These layers make your office feel more like a living space and less like a work zone.


4. Bring in Natural Elements
Nature has a calming effect, which is perfect for productivity.
Add:
Indoor plants
Wooden desk accessories
Woven baskets
Even one small plant can make a big difference in how your space feels.


5. Create a Dedicated Corner
You don’t need a full room to have a cozy office.
Use:
A corner of your bedroom
A small nook
An unused wall
Define the space with a desk, chair, and decor so it feels intentional.


6. Keep It Clutter-Free but Personal
A cozy space should feel calm—not chaotic.
Balance it by:
Keeping essentials only on your desk
Adding a few personal touches (photos, candles, books)
This keeps your space functional while still feeling like “you.”


7. Choose a Soft Color Palette
Colors affect your mood more than you think.
Go for:
Warm whites
Beige and taupe
Soft pastels
These shades create a peaceful environment that helps you stay focused.


8. Add Wall Decor That Inspires You
Blank walls can feel dull. Add decor that motivates and comforts you.
Ideas:
Minimal art prints
Vision boards
Shelves with decor pieces
Keep it simple so it doesn’t overwhelm the space.


9. Incorporate Cozy Scents
This is often overlooked but very powerful.
Use:
Scented candles
Essential oil diffusers
Scents like vanilla, lavender, or sandalwood can make your workspace feel relaxing and inviting.


10. Make It Seasonal and Flexible
Your cozy office can evolve with the seasons.
For example:
Add warm blankets in winter
Use lighter textures in summer
Small updates keep your space feeling fresh and exciting.


Final Thoughts
A cozy home office is all about creating a space that supports both comfort and productivity. You don’t need a big budget or a large room—just thoughtful details that make your workspace feel warm, personal, and functional.
